WebMar 5, 2024 · Biogas is about 20% lighter than air and has an ignition temperature in the range of 650 to 750 degrees C. (1,200-1,380 degrees F.). It is an odorless and colorless gas that burns with a clear blue flame similar to that of natural gas. However, biogas has a calorific value of 20-26 MJ/m3 (537-700 Btu/ft3) compared to commercial quality natural ... The two main components of this resulting gas are methane (CH 4) and carbon dioxide (CO 2 ). Upgrading means that the methane is separated from the carbon dioxide, resulting in a very pure methane gas flow.
